Hybrid meetings and corporate broadcasts have exposed a structural weakness in conventional video conferencing, namely sustained flat-screen interaction. When a leadership town hall, investor update, product launch, or internal training session is delivered through a grid of static webcam feeds, the audience is forced into a visually compressed and cognitively repetitive experience. A 3D virtual corporate stream is not simply a camera feed placed inside a graphics package. It is a tightly engineered live production system that combines real-time camera acquisition, studio-grade audio, broadcast switching, 3D scene design, encoder configuration, network transport, and platform integration into a single end-to-end workflow. There are many similarities between a webinar and a webcast. These include the way they are broadcasted to the viewers and the method of engagement of the audience. However, the main difference sets in by the technology that the two process use. Both have different green screen video packages. A webcast’s main purpose is to convey information to large online attendees. A webinar is more suited for online events that mandate active collaboration and interaction amongst the presenter and the viewers.
